1-Turbotax does not support form 1042s directly, but you can enter the income based on the income code.
Because you are a resident alien and you have received a form 1042S where you report the income depends on the income code and why the form was generated. See page 18 for a description of income code.IRS Instructions Form 1042-S.
This income can be entered as miscellaneous income. When you sign into your TurboTax account you can follow the steps below.
- Select the "Federal" tab in the black navigation bar on the left
- Select "Income & Expenses"
- Select "Add more income" button if necessary
- Scroll and click "See the list of all income"
- Scroll to "Less Common Income" and select "show more"
- Select "Miscellaneous Income"
- Scroll and select "Other Reportable Income"
- Click "yes" then enter the description and amount (this will show up on line 21, Form 1040)
2-The entry steps you have in your question is correct. Enter the federal and/or state withholding here:
- Deductions and credits/Other income taxes/Yes/Other income taxes paid in 2017/Withholding not already entered on a W2 or 1099
3-The results should be correct following the steps above.
You should file your return by mail so that you can attach your Form 1042-S to the return.
